The European countries France and Germany have declared that their economy has grown by 0.3%  taking into account from April to June, which makes them the first to exit recession.

Experts on the other hand said that they had expected this growth from the European nations and is not surprise that they exit the recession.

French Finance and Economy Minister Christine Lagarde  added, “The data is very surprising. After four negative quarters France is coming out of the red,”.

This is all thanks to the exports that Germany managed. Last june it is recorded that Germany exports where 7% higher meanwhile last year it was 3.8%.
